In the heart of a small town near I-44, Lite Pan serves generous, fresh Chinese fare—notably a much-praised hot-and-sour soup and surprisingly good sushi—alongside a lunch buffet and wallet-friendly portions. The clean, casual spot is popular with families and travelers for fast service, though experiences vary: phone orders, occasional buffet items and ribs can disappoint, and staff interactions have sometimes been unprofessional. Despite inconsistency, it remains a beloved local staple worth trying.
